Minimizing thick plants is a important element of landscape management, assisting to bring back order, enhance looks,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can limit air flow, decrease sunshine penetration, and produce chances for insects and disease. Pruning and thinning are the primary approaches for handling dense or unruly plant life, permitting plants to flourish while preserving a regulated appearance. The process includes selectively removing excess branches, stems, and foliage, constantly considering the natural development routine of each species. Timing is important; some plants react best to pruning during inactivity, while flowering varieties may require post-bloom trimming to protect blossoms. Correct strategy guarantees cuts are tidy and positioned to motivate healthy brand-new development. In addition to enhancing plant health, lowering overgrowth enhances availability and presence in the landscape Paths, driveways, and outside home become much safer and more welcoming. Long-term upkeep strategies avoid future overgrowth, guaranteeing a well balanced and unified landscape.
